ATO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2017 in Review

425 of the 4,409 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Atmos Energy (ATO) for Q4 2017, worth a combined $6.95B — up 8.9% from $6.38B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 67 funds opened new ATO positions and 39 closed out — a net gain of 28 holders — while 143 added to existing stakes and 135 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Zimmer Partners, opening a new position worth an estimated $178M. The largest seller was Victory Capital Management, cutting an estimated $74M.
